Garden Pavers Installation in Norwalk, CT
Garden pavers installation services involve placing durable, decorative stones or bricks to create functional and attractive outdoor surfaces. These projects typically include pat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or seating areas, enhancing both the aesthetic appeal and usability of a property’s outdoor space. Homeowners often seek this service to improve curb appeal, define specific zones within their yard, or replace worn-out surfaces with long-lasting materials that require minimal maintenance.
Before requesting garden pavers installation, property owners should consider factors such as the desired style and color of the pavers, the size and layout of the area to be paved, and any existing landscape features that might influence the design. It’s also helpful to understand the drainage requirements and the typical lifespan of different materials to ensure the selected pavers meet long-term expectations. Clarifying these details can assist in planning a project that aligns with both aesthetic preferences and practical needs.

Garden Pavers Installation Questions
What types of garden pavers are available for installation? There are various options including concrete, natural stone, brick, and slate, suitable for different aesthetic preferences and durability needs.
Can garden pavers be installed on uneven ground? Yes, proper preparation and leveling ensure stable installation even on uneven surfaces.
What are common uses for garden pavers? They are often used for patios, walkways, driveway accents, and outdoor seating areas.
How should garden pavers be maintained after installation? Regular cleaning and occasional resealing help maintain their appearance and longevity.
